2,147,492,381 is a composite number, odd.
2,147,492,381 (two billion one hundred forty-seven million four hundred ninety-two thousand three hundred eighty-one) is an odd 10-digit number. It is a composite number with 4 divisors, and factors as 199 × 10,791,419. Written other ways, in hexadecimal, 0x8000221D.
